Hi All,

Last week it seemd like a good idea to move data from GoDaddies North America servers to a European one, this happed ok but it broke the SSL certificate, I was nervous of the Rekey process, but it seemed to go ok, my problem is the Meteobridge is coming up with an error and the site is extreamly slow which I think is down to MB not uploading the weather conditions detail.

Does the MB need flushing so that it can reload the new cert details, or is their a step I've left out during the rekey process which is causing problems.

My sites a bit sad at the moment  :-(

Cheers

Ian

UPDATE = Boris said the MB Pro error is due to a timeout rather than certificate error.

Please try the http address you are sending data to with your browser. The error message indicates the the URL you try to reach out for is not responding as expected.

Hi Docbee,

The problem turned out to be with GoDaddy, reverting back to the North American server from the one in Europe cured the issue, this is a thread on the problem: http://www.wxforum.net/index.php?topic=33058.msg334919;topicseen#msg334919
